fre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

(16)若變量已正確定義并賦值,下面符合c語言語法的表達式是()(編輯修改稿)

2024-09-28 04:34 本頁面
 

【文章內(nèi)容簡介】 )。 printf(\n)。 } } 三、程序分析題 閱讀下列程序,將輸出結(jié)果分別寫到各題右側(cè)的空白處。 16. main() { int a=3, b=9, c=2。 if(a) if(b) printf(%5d%5d%5d\n, a, b, c)。 } 程序運行結(jié)果: ????3????9????2 17. void change(int *x, int y) { int t。 t=*x。 *x=y。 y=t。 } main( ) { int a=3, b=5。 14 change(amp。a,b)。 printf(a=%d,b=%d\n,a,b)。 } 程序運行結(jié)果: a=5,b=5 18. main( ) { int j。 for(j=4。 j=2。 j) switch( j ) { case 0: printf(%4s,ABC)。 case 1: printf(%4s,DEF)。 case 2: printf(%4s,GHI)。 break。 case 3: printf(%4s,JKL)。 default: printf(%4s,MNO)。 } printf(\n)。 } 程序運行結(jié)果: ?MNO?JKL?MNO?GHI 19. main( ) { static int j,a[6]={1,2}。 for(j=3。 j6。 j++) a[j]=a[j/2]+a[j%3]a[j2]。 for(j=0。 j6。 j++) printf(%5d,a[j])。 printf(\n)。 } 程序運行結(jié)果: ????1????2????0 ????1???? 2????1 20. int a=10。 int f(int a) { int b=0。 static int c=3。 a++。 ++c。 ++b。 return a+b+c。 } main( ) { int i。 for(i=0。i2。i++)print(%5d,f(a))。 15 printf(\n)。 } 程序運行結(jié)果: ???16???17 21. define N 2 define M N+1 define NUM 2*M+1 int fib(int n) { return n3?2:fib(n1)+fib(n2)。 } main() { printf(%5d%5d\n,NUM,fib(5))。 } 程序運行結(jié)果: ????6???10 DOS 提示符下顯示源程序如下 ( 程序也在 C 盤中 ): C:\type main(int argc,char *argv[ ]) {while(argc0) printf(%s,argv[argc])。 printf(\n)。 } 16 寫出執(zhí)行下列 命令后的輸出結(jié)果 C:\PROG 2020 OLYMPIC BEIJING 回車 程序運行結(jié)果 : BEIJINGOLYMPIC2020 2020年 4 月二級 C 語言筆試試題及參考解答 一、選擇題: 1MB 等于( ) A) 1000 字節(jié) B) 1024 字節(jié) C) 1000*1000 字節(jié) D) 1024*1024 字節(jié) 與十六進制數(shù) 200等值的十進制數(shù)為( ) A) 256 B) 512 C) 1024 D) 2048 所謂 裸機 是指( ) A) 單片機 B) 單板機 C) 不裝備任何軟件的計算機 D) 只裝備操作系統(tǒng)的計算機 能將高級語言編寫的源程序轉(zhuǎn)換為目標程序的是( ) A) 鏈接程序 B) 解釋程序 C) 編譯程序 D) 編輯程序 在 64位計算機中,一個字長所占字節(jié)數(shù)為( ) A) 64 B) 8 C) 4 D) 1 在 Windows環(huán)境下,當(dāng)一個應(yīng)用程序窗口被最小化后,該應(yīng)用程序( ) A) 繼續(xù)在后臺運行 B) 繼續(xù)在前臺運行 C) 終止運行 D) 暫停運行 在 Windows 環(huán)境下,能實現(xiàn)窗口移動的操作是( ) A)用鼠標拖動窗口中的任何部位 B)用鼠標拖動窗口的邊框 C)用鼠標拖動窗口的控制按鈕 D)用鼠標拖動窗口的標題欄 在 Windows 環(huán)境下, PrintScreen 鍵的作用是( ) A)打印當(dāng)前窗口的內(nèi)容 B)打印屏幕內(nèi)容 C)復(fù)制屏幕到剪貼板 D)復(fù)制當(dāng)前窗口到剪貼板 Inter 的通信協(xié)議是( ) A)TCP/IP B)BBS C)WWW D)FTP 下列敘述中正確的是( ) A)計算機病毒只感染可執(zhí)行文件 B)計算機病毒只感染文本文件 C)計算機病毒只能通過軟件復(fù)制的方式進行傳播 D)計算機病毒可以通過網(wǎng)絡(luò)或讀寫磁盤方式進行傳播 17 1一個算法應(yīng)該具有 確定性 等 5 個特性,下面對另外 4 個特性的描述中錯誤的是( ) A)有零個或多個輸入 B)有零個或多個輸出 C) 有窮性 D)可行性 1以下敘述中正確的是( ) A)C 語言的源程序不必通過編譯就可以直接運行 B)C 語言中的每條可執(zhí)行語句最終都將被轉(zhuǎn)換成二進制的機器指令 C)C源程序經(jīng)編譯形成的二進制代碼可以直接運行 D)C 語言中的函數(shù)不可以單獨進行編譯 1以下符合 C 語言語法的實型常量是( ) A) B) C).5E3 D)E15 1以下 4 組用戶定義標識符中,全部合法的一組是() A) _main B) If C) txt D) int enclude max REAL k_2 sin turbo 3COM _001 1若以下選項中的變量已正確定義,則正確的賦值語句是() A)x1=%3 B)1+2=x2 C)x3=0x12 D)x4=1+2=3。 1設(shè)有以下定義 int a=0。 double b=。 char c=?A?。 define d 2 則下面語句中錯誤的是( ) A)a++。 B)b++ C)c++。 D)d++。 1設(shè)有定義: float a=2,b=4,h=3。,以下 C語言表達式與代數(shù)式計算結(jié)果不相符的是( ) A)(a+b)*h/2 B)(1/2)*(a+b)*h C)(a+b)*h*1/2 D)h/2*(a+b) 1有以下程序 main( ) { int x=102, y=012。 printf(%2d,%2d\n,x,y)。 } 執(zhí)行后輸出結(jié)果是() A)10,01 B) 002,12 C)102,10 D)02,10 1以下 4 個選項中,不能看作一條語句的是() A) {。} B)a=0,b=0,c=0。 C)if(a0)。 D)if(b==0) m=1。n=2。 18 設(shè)有定義: int a,*pa=amp。a。以下 scanf語句中能正確為變量 a讀入數(shù)據(jù)的是( ) A)scanf(%d,pa)。 B)scanf(%d,a)。 C)scanf(%d,amp。pa)。 D)scanf(%d,*pa)。 2以下程序段中與語句 k=ab?(bc?1:0):0;功能等價的是()A) if ((ab)amp。amp。(bc)) k=1。 else k=0。 B) if ((ab)||(bc)) k=1; else k=0。 C) if (a=b) k=0。 D) if (ab) k=1。 else if(b=c) k=1。 else if(b c) k=1。 else k=0。 2有以下程序 main( ) { char k。 int i。 for(i=1。i3。i++) { scanf(%c,amp。k)。 switch(k) { case ?0?: printf(another\n)。 case ?1?: printf(number\n)。 } } } 程序運行時,從鍵盤輸入: 01回車 ,程序執(zhí)行后的輸出結(jié)果是( ) A) another B) another C) another D) number number number number number another number 2有以下程序 main( ) { int x=0,y=5,z=3。 while(z0amp。amp。++x5) y=y1。 printf(%d,%d,%d\n,x,y,z)。 19 } 程序執(zhí)行后的輸出結(jié)果是( ) A)3,2,0 B)3,2,1 C)4,3,1 D)5,2,5 2有以下程序 main( ) { int i,s=0。 for(i=1。i10。i+=2) s+=i+1。 printf(%d\n,s)。 } 程序執(zhí)行后的輸出結(jié)果是() A)自然數(shù) 1~ 9 的累加和 B)自然數(shù) 1~ 10的累加和 C)自然數(shù) 1~ 9 中的奇數(shù)之和 D)自然數(shù) 1~ 10中的偶數(shù)之 2有以下程序 main( ) { int i,n=0。 for(i=2。i5。i++) { do { if(i%3) continue。 n++。 } while(!i)。 n++。 } printf(n=%d\n,n)。 } 程序執(zhí)行后的輸出結(jié)果是() A)n=5 B)n=2 C)n=3 D) n=4 2若程序中定義了以下函數(shù) 20 double myadd(double a, double b) { return (a+b)。 } 并將其放在調(diào)用語句之后,則在調(diào)用之前應(yīng)該對該函數(shù)進行說明,以下選項中錯誤的說明是( ) A) double myadd(double a,b)。 B)double myadd(double,double)。 C)double myadd(double b,double a)。 D)double myadd(double x,double y)。 2有以下程序 char fun(char x , char y) { if(xy) return x。 return y。 } main( ) { int a=?9?,b=?8?,c=?7?。 printf(%c\n,fun(fun(a,b),fun(b,c)))。 } 程序的執(zhí)行結(jié)果是( )
點擊復(fù)制文檔內(nèi)容
畢業(yè)設(shè)計相關(guān)推薦
文庫吧 www.dybbs8.com
備案圖片鄂ICP備17016276號-1